Observations of Jupiter from the Vainu Bappu Observatory

We used the 1 meter telescope at the Vainu Bappu Observatory and obtained images on 18th and 19th through narrow and medium (100 A) pass band filters (8930 NB, 8900 BP, 6581, 5083, 4935 and 4862 A). The crash spots and the south pole appear very bright in the methane band at 8930. The crash spots appear dark with good contrast in the other filters. At the 2.34 meter telescope long slit spectra in the region 4900 - 7400 A of the crash latitude were taken. No obvious changes in the spectrum at the crash spot is immediately apparent. More detailed analysis will be required to detect small changes.
